automatic dependency installation has been added to these plugins quite recently and is triggered by the eric plugin manager. However, this will be part of the next eric release (21.6). Before that eric did not install such plugin dependencies automatically.

Just tried removing eric_env and running

  * |cd ~|
  * |python3 -m venv eric_env|
  * |~/eric_env/bin/python3 -m pip install --upgrade pip|
  * |~/eric_env/bin/python3 -m pip install eric-ide|
  * |~/eric_env/bin/eric6_post_install|

and it worked fine!
